Health Care Forum
07/10/2008 7:00pm
Mountain View City Council Chambers, 2nd Floor, 500 Castro St., Mountain View, North County

The health care crisis - How are the needs of the uninsured being met in Santa Clara County until Single Payer becomes a reality? Free and open to the public. Featuring the documentary “The Healthcare Solution: California OneCare”, and a panel of Santa Clara County health care leaders: Kim Roberts, CEO, Santa Clara Valley Health and Hospital System; Leona Butler, CEO, Santa Clara Family Health Plan; Nancy Pena, PhD, Director, Mental Health Department, Santa Clara Valley Health and Hospital System. Moderated by Lynn Huidekoper, RN, Health Care for All-California. Sponsored by the Peninsula Democratic Coalition, Health Care for All-Santa Clara County chapter, and the Santa Clara County Single Payer Coalition. Refreshments served at 6:30 pm. New Citizen Swear-in Ceremony
07/24/2008 10:00am
Campbell Community Center - Heritage Theater, 1 West Campbell Avenue in Campbell (off Winchester), Campbell/Cupertino/Saratoga/Los Gatos

Help deliver a welcome from the Democratic Party to brand new Americans. It's a great place to show off your foreign language skills. Naturalization ceremonies take place starting at 10:30am, 1:15pm & 3:30pm, each lasting about an hour. We need to be ready about 45 minutes before each group goes in...... The main opportunity for us is to distribute Democratic Party literature. Most voter registration takes place inside the event, assisted by the Registrar of Voters...... This is really a festive and inspiring day. The first 2 sessions are the busiest, with the 800 seat Heritage Theater packed with both new citizens and their families. 1200-1400 citizens are processed in total. People pour out all at once at the end times, with some milling about for well wishes, so the best time to reach them is as they queue up to enter...... Meet at ~10:00am (in front of the Heritage Theater, by the fountains), or come later and stay for as long as you're able...... Parking gets tight; try nearby neighborhood streets. Or beat the parking hassle -- Campbell Community Center has excellent transit access; it's right on lines 26 and 60, and about a half-mile or so walk from the Light Rail station. See VTA website www.vta.org for schedule information...... Registration supplies and local party literature provided. There’s a nearby sandwich/snack bar operating all day. Good ideas: an umbrella or sun protection, comfortable clothes, and water...... Please call 408-219-4896 or e-mail volunteer@sccdp.org to sign up or for more info.
